In the present work, we study the production problem of the charmed baryon Λc(2860)+ at ̅PANDA. With the JP=3/2+ assignment to Λc(2860)+, an effective Lagrangian approach is adopted to calculate the cross section of p̅p→Λ-cΛc(2860)+. The Dalitz plot analysis and the D0p invariant mass spectrum distribution are also given for the p̅p→Λ-cΛc(2860)+→Λ-cpD0 process. The numerical results show that the total cross section may reach up to about 10 μb. With the designed luminosity of ̅PANDA (2×1032 cm-2 s-1), about 108 Λc(2860) events can be expected per day by reconstructing the final pD0. [ABSTRACT FROM AUTHOR]
